The Saint Andrews Distance-learning Afghanistan Scholarship for MSc TESOL for the academic year 2023/24 has been announced by the University of St Andrews to assist candidates by helping to defray the cost of pursuing postgraduate education in the UK.
The scholarship is only available to Afghan students who plan to start the distance-learning MSc TESOL program at St. Andrew’s. The scholarship grant will cover all tuition costs for the distance-learning MSc TESOL program.

Benefits of the Afghanistan Scholarship at St Andrews Distant Learning
This scholarship covers all tuition fees for the University of St. Andrews’ Distance Learning MSc International Education program or MSc TESOL program (including MSc TESOL with a specialization).
NOTE: In the event that no suitable entries are provided, the International Education Institute has the right to withhold an award. The prize will be decided by a committee.
The grant cannot be transferred to another program of study and there is no monetary substitute available. The funding will be revoked if a student does not enroll in a distance-learning MSc TESOL or International Education program.
Eligibility Criteria for Afghanistan Scholarship at St Andrews Distant Learning
To apply, you must:
- Be an Afghan national who now resides in Afghanistan or who did so during the last three years.
- Hold a place in an MSc TESOL (Distance Learning, September start) or MSc International Education (Distance Learning, September start) course at the University of St Andrews by the scholarship submission cutoff date.
Documents Requirement
The university requires the following paperwork from the students:
- Describe in a 1000-word proposal how you intend to apply the program’s lessons to help the Afghan people.
- CV or a resume.
- A declaration of self.
- A pair of authentic signed academic recommendations.
- Degree certificates and academic credentials.
- Individual Statement.
- The institution expects the students to present documentation of their English language competency.
How to Apply for the Afghanistan Scholarship at St Andrews Distant Learning?
- Open “My application” and log in by clicking the apply now button below. To view “My application,” you must wait until the following working day if you recently filed your application to study.
- Find Scholarships and grants under “Useful links” and select it.
- Choose to See the list of financing opportunities.
- Enter the academic year, award type (if applying for the Accommodation Award, select “Accommodation” instead of “Tuition and upkeep”), and study level in the “Funding search” box. Don’t pay attention to the residence and school boxes. Tap Refresh list.
- An extensive list of scholarships will now appear. Search for the name of the scholarship in the Filter box to locate it.
- The next step is to submit an application for a specific scholarship. The system will reject your application if one of your responses shows you are ineligible for a fund (for example, you are applying for a scholarship that is only for candidates residing in Pakistan but you state that you do not live in Afghanistan). If you gave the wrong response, you can go back and update your application information before resubmitting it for the fund.
